Puppies require significantly higher nutrient densities than adult dogs. During growth, energy needs are up to twice that of mature dogs per kilogram of body weight, with heightened demands for amino acids, essential fatty acids, macro-minerals (Calcium and Phosphorus), and micro-nutrients. For Egyptian pet food brands, delivering a product that balances rapid growth without triggering skeletal abnormalities (such as hip dysplasia in popular Egyptian working breeds like German Shepherds, Belgian Malinois, and Golden Retrievers) is crucial for building long-term brand equity.
Formulated at a precise 1.2:1 to 1.4:1 ratio. This structural balance ensures proper bone mineralization in both large breed working puppies and toy breed companion dogs, mitigating metabolic bone disorders common in rapid-growth phases.
Utilizing thermal-vacuum fat coating technology, lipids and Omega-3 fatty acids (DHA/EPA for brain and retinal development) are infused deep into the kibble core, protected by natural vitamin E and rosemary extracts to withstand Egyptian summer heat.
Enriched with Prebiotics (FOS & MOS) and beet pulp fibre to stabilize gut microbiota, promoting small, firm stools and reducing gastrointestinal distress—a critical factor for puppies acclimating to warm urban environments.
The table below highlights standard analytical constituents engineered in our Hungarian manufacturing plant for export to the Middle East & North Africa (MENA) region:
| Analytical Constituent | Standard Puppy Kibble | High-Protein Working Puppy | Hypoallergenic Duck & Pear | Adult Maintenance Kibble |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Crude Protein (min) | 28.0% | 32.0% | 26.0% | 22.0% – 25.0% |
| Crude Fat (min) | 14.0% | 18.0% | 12.0% | 10.0% – 14.0% |
| Crude Ash (max) | 7.5% | 8.0% | 7.0% | 8.5% |
| Crude Fibre (max) | 3.0% | 2.8% | 3.5% | 3.8% |
| Moisture (max) | 9.0% | 8.5% | 9.0% | 9.5% |
| Calcium / Phosphorus | 1.3% / 1.0% | 1.4% / 1.1% | 1.2% / 0.9% | 1.1% / 0.8% |
| Kibble Size (Diameter) | 6mm – 8mm (Triangle/Heart) | 8mm – 10mm (Round) | 7mm – 9mm (Disc) | 12mm – 16mm (Multi-Shape) |

In Egypt, working breeds such as German Shepherds, Belgian Malinois, Cane Corsos, and Rottweilers are widely kept for property security and personal protection in suburban compounds. Puppies of these breeds require elevated protein levels (30%+) and reinforced joint care nutrients (Glucosamine and Chondroitin) to support rapid muscle growth and skeletal strain. In high-density apartment districts in Cairo and Alexandria, toy and small breeds (French Bulldogs, Shih Tzus, Pugs, Pomeranians) dominate household pet ownership. These puppies have smaller mouths, shorter gastrointestinal tracts, and higher metabolic rates. We produce mini-bit kibble geometries (5mm–7mm) enriched with Omega-6 fatty acids for skin barrier health, tear-stain reducing ingredients (e.g., Duck & Pear hypoallergenic bases), and Odour-Control Yucca Schidigera extracts to maintain indoor air quality.

We supply high-barrier 3-layer aluminum/PET/PE laminate foil bags and heavy-duty multi-wall paper bags with inner polyethylene moisture barriers. These packaging solutions feature low Oxygen Transmission Rates (OTR) and Water Vapor Transmission Rates (WVTR), shielding the kibble fats from oxidation and atmospheric humidity even when stored in non-refrigerated distribution warehouses in warm regions like Cairo or Aswan.
